Jaker Ali Demonstrates Sportsmanship in WI vs BAN T20I: A Moment of Integrity in Cricket

In a remarkable display of sportsmanship, Bangladesh’s Jaker Ali showcased his integrity during the third T20I match against the West Indies on December 15, 2024, at the Arnos Vale Ground in Kingstown. His thoughtful decision to refrain from running for a third after seeing West Indies’ Obed McCoy injured went viral, capturing the hearts of cricket fans worldwide. The moment of respect and compassion was highlighted during Bangladesh’s dominant 80-run victory, securing a historic 3-0 series whitewash against the West Indies in the T20I series.

The Incident that Captured the Essence of Sportsmanship

The incident unfolded during the 14th over of Bangladesh’s innings when Jaker Ali, alongside his partner Shamim Hossain, was running between the wickets. After Jaker swiped at a fullish delivery from Gudakesh Motie and sent the ball over mid-wicket, West Indies’ Obed McCoy attempted to intercept the ball by diving to his left. In an unfortunate turn of events, McCoy missed the catch, injuring his shoulder in the process.

As McCoy lay on the ground in visible discomfort, Jaker and Shamim had already completed two runs, and the third run seemed imminent. However, upon noticing McCoy’s injury, Jaker made a swift decision. He turned down the third run, showing immense sportsmanship and respect for his opponent’s well-being. This gesture was immediately praised by commentators and cricket fans alike, as it reflected the true spirit of the game, putting respect for players above personal achievement.

Bangladesh’s Dominant Performance and Historic Win

The incident with McCoy aside, Jaker Ali’s own performance with the bat was a key factor in Bangladesh’s victory. Jaker remained not out for an impressive 72 runs off 41 balls, anchoring the Bangladesh innings as they set a formidable total of 189/7 in 20 overs. His powerful knock included several boundaries and sixes, displaying both technique and aggression.

Parvez Hossain Emon supported Jaker with a valuable 39 runs, but it was the overall team effort that took Bangladesh to an unassailable position. In reply, the West Indies were unable to chase the challenging target, succumbing to the disciplined Bangladesh bowling attack. The home side was bowled out for just 109 runs in 16.4 overs, sealing a dominant 80-run victory for Bangladesh.

Rishad Hossain starred with the ball, taking 3 wickets for 14 runs. Taskin Ahmed and Mahedi Hasan also played crucial roles, claiming two wickets each and ensuring the West Indies never had a foothold in the chase. Despite a valiant effort from Romario Shepherd (33) and Johnson Charles (23), the West Indies fell short of the target.
